You are the playwright
and you’re writing a play.
The play is titled
”My Life in Three Acts.”
It’s up to you to decide
how much drama you want in your play,
how much conflict,
how much humor.
As the playwright
you have a lot of choices to make.
It’s up to you to decide
which characters you want in your play.
You have the power
to include those you want
and exclude those you don’t want.
The First Act of your “Your Life” is completed.
Depending on your age,
you are in the Second Act or Third.
How you finish the play
and write the ending
is up to you.
You are the playwright.
The power is in your hand.
There is an erasure on your pencil
to make changes and adjustments as you go.
You are the playwright.
Make the ending a good one.
